Release Notes

redis/go-redis (github.com/redis/go-redis/v9)

v9.21.0: 9.21.0

Compare Source

This is a minor release adding new features and bug fixes. There are no breaking changes; upgrading from 9.20.x is a drop-in replacement.

🚀 Highlights

Zero-copy GetToBuffer / SetFromBuffer

Two new StringCmdable methods let callers read and write Redis string values directly into and from pre-allocated byte buffers, eliminating the per-call payload allocation that Get/Set incur:

GetToBuffer(ctx, key, buf) *ZeroCopyStringCmd   // reads into buf; ZeroCopyStringCmd { Val() int; Bytes() []byte; Result() (int, error) }
SetFromBuffer(ctx, key, buf) *StatusCmd

GetToBuffer decodes the bulk reply straight into the caller-owned buf (no intermediate allocation); a buffer that is too small returns an error after draining the payload, so the connection stays aligned for the next reply. SetFromBuffer is provided for API symmetry — it dispatches to the same []byte writer path as Set(ctx, key, buf, 0) and produces byte-identical output on the wire. Available on *Client, *ClusterClient, *Ring, *Conn and Pipeliner.

(#​3834) by @​ndyakov

Explicit LIMIT 0 for stream trimming

Redis treats XTRIM/XADD approximate-trim (~) LIMIT 0 as "disable the trimming effort cap entirely", which differs from omitting LIMIT (the implicit 100 * stream-node-max-entries default). The command builders previously only emitted LIMIT when limit > 0, so callers could never send an explicit LIMIT 0. Following the KeepTTL = -1 precedent, the new XTrimLimitDisabled = -1 sentinel now emits an explicit LIMIT 0; limit == 0 keeps the historical no-LIMIT behavior, so existing callers produce byte-identical commands.

(#​3848) by @​TheRealMal

✨ New Features

  • Zero-copy buffer string commands: new GetToBuffer / SetFromBuffer on StringCmdable and the ZeroCopyStringCmd result type, reading/writing string values into caller-owned buffers without per-call payload allocation (#​3834) by @​ndyakov
  • XTrimLimitDisabled sentinel: XTRIM/XADD approximate trimming can now send an explicit LIMIT 0 to disable the trim effort cap, via the new XTrimLimitDisabled = -1 sentinel (#​3848) by @​TheRealMal
  • PubSub health-check timeouts: channel.initHealthCheck now bounds the Ping it issues with a fresh per-check timeout context (the exported pingTimeout / reconnectTimeout) instead of context.TODO(), so a stuck health-check Ping can no longer block indefinitely (#​3819) by @​abdellani
  • Skip redundant UNWATCH in Tx.Close: a transaction now tracks whether a WATCH is still active (watchArmed) and only issues UNWATCH on Close when it is, removing an extra round trip on the common WATCH/.../EXEC and no-key Watch paths while never returning a connection to the pool with an active watch (#​3854) by @​fcostaoliveira

🐛 Bug Fixes

  • maintnotifications ModeAuto fail-open: ModeAuto now stays fail-open when the server does not support maintenance notifications — connections are retired and tracking is guarded during downgrade so the client keeps working instead of erroring (#​3853) by @​terrorobe
